  • Aged care has been another “flop” from the Labor party as the fast-tracking of visas from people overseas has only seen “155 workers” brought into the country for work, Sky News host Paul Murray says.
    “Amazingly today … just two per cent of visas have been granted under the scheme almost a year after it was established,” Mr Murray said.
    “We are now just talking about 155 workers that have been brought into the country to work in our aged care facilities.
    “After the government said they were planning to fast-track those people into our country.
    “What a surprise, another Labor fail.”
